Protein Information
Name KMT2D
Synonyms ALR, MLL2, MLL4
Function Histone methyltransferase that catalyzes methyl group transfer from S-adenosyl-L-methionine to the epsilon-amino group of 'Lys-4' of histone H3 (H3K4) (PubMed:25561738). Part of chromatin remodeling machinery predominantly forms H3K4me1 methylation marks at active chromatin sites where transcription and DNA repair take place (PubMed:25561738, PubMed:17500065). Acts as a coactivator for estrogen receptor by being recruited by ESR1, thereby activating transcription (PubMed:16603732).
Cellular Location Nucleus.
Tissue Location Expressed in most adult tissues, including a variety of hematoipoietic cells, with the exception of the liver
